MagicLink™ Oligo Antibody Conjugation Kit
Oligonucleotide can be conjugated to antibody/protein by thiol-maleimide and hydrazone coupling approaches. The thiol-maleimide approach is commonly performed with a bifunctional linker (such as SMCC). However, SMCC-modified protein is extremely unstable and often self-reactive since it often contains both amine and thiol groups that cause a significant amount of homo-crosslinking. The conjugation linkage is exchangeable when other thiol groups are present. In the hydrazonecoupling approach, the conjugation reaction is based on a reaction between hydrazine and aldehyde. This method is low yielding although a catalyst is used. The size of the molecule and inaccessibility of the functional group contribute to low yield. In addition, linkage stability is an issue.
A typical flow chart of oligo-antibody conjugation by MagicLink technology
BroadPharm's MagicLink™ technology solves all the problems by combining PEG and proprietary crosslinking chemistry. MagicLink™ chemistry and kit do not need TCEP, DTT, or catalysts at all! First, antibody reacts with LINK NHS ester to introduce LINK into the antibody. Also, amine modified oligonucleotide reacts with MAGIC NHS ester to introduce MAGIC into the oligonucleotide structure. Second, after purification of both reactive partners, they instantly react with each other yielding an antibody- oligonucleotide conjugate with a stable ring linkage.

The kit can also be used to conjugate oligonucleotides to alkaline phosphatase (AP), horseradish peroxidase (HRP), bovine serum albumin (BSA), soybean peroxidase (SBP), penicillinase (PNC), streptavidin and its conjugates, alpha-D-galactosidase, glucose-t-phosphate dehydrogenase, etc. Such oligonucleotide-enzyme conjugates ("oligozymes") can be used in a variety of hybridization and detection formats, including dot blots, Southern/Northern blots, in situ and solution hybridization/capture schemes.

Applications; MagicLink Oligo antibody Labeling Kits are used to conjugate oligo with primary antibody, secondary antibodies, enzymes, etc. for the bioassays below. Oligo-antibody application: · Immuno-Polymerase Chain Reaction (immuno-PCR) · Proximity Ligation Assay (PLA) · Electrochemical Proximity Assay (ECPA) · Multiplexed Assay Development · Proximity extension assay · 3DNA technology in lateral flow · 3DNA technology in cellular targeting · Single cell CITE-seq experiments · DNA-PAINT imaging · Protein arrays Oligozymes application: · Dot blots, · Southern/Northern blots, · In situ, and solution hybridization/capture
